English & Language Arts Education is the 214th most popular major in the country with 3,113 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Texas, there were 69 English and language arts education gra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 4 English and language arts education graduates with average earnings and debt of $35,954 and $18,599 respectively.

This year’s “Schools for an Associate Highly Focused on English & Language Arts Education Major in Texas” ranking looked at 2 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in English and language arts education. The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their English and language arts education program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.

Del Mar College
Corpus Christi, Texas

Out of the 2 schools in the Schools for an Associate Highly Focused on English & Language Arts Education Major in Texas that were part of this year’s ranking, Del Mar College landed the #1 spot on the list. Located in Corpus Christi, Texas, this fairly large public school handed out 4 degrees to qualified associates’s English and language arts education students in 2020-2021.
